A couple of people have mentioned they can't get their pharmacies to

order CoQ10. We had the same problem. I heard the same song and dance

about how they can only use their wholesaler, and the wholesaler doesn't

carry it. But, thanks to another mito parent who paved the way, I am

finally getting it (the Tishcon brand) through a CVS pharmacy here in

Indiana, and it is being paid for by Indiana Medicaid. I'm guessing the

pharmacy is ordering directly from Tishcon.

Since CVS pharmacy is a chain, just thought it might help someone who has

a CVS where they live to know it's being done at another store in the

chain (two in our area, actually.) I would be happy to email the

location of our CVS and the name of the person there who helped us sort

through the red tape if anyone wants to try and convince their local CVS

to call and find out how our store is doing it.
